Welcome to the Glimmerbase team! Our user-profile store outgrew a single Pondera cluster about a year ago, so we shard by a hash of the account's region-salted ID. Reads fan out through the router, writes pin to the owning shard, and rebalancing happens during the weekly quiet window. Don't change shard counts casually — resplits are painful and Marisol will find you. The current sharding knobs, which live in config and get hot-reloaded, are as follows.

tuning constants:
RATE_LIMITS = {
    "wenwyn": 1,
    "zorix": 10,
    "oliix": 2,
    "holael": 10,
}

**Action item (INC follow-up): Varrow Assign service**

Sticky assignments expired early during the outage, so some users flipped experiment arms mid-session. Support: if customers report inconsistent features, check assignment timestamps before escalating. Fix shipped; TTLs and cache bounds were retuned to prevent recurrence. Do not manually reassign users. Escalate only if flips persist past the new TTL window. Revised constants are listed below.

tuning table, yaweg-kajef:
WEIGHTS = {
    "ralwyn": 573,
    "praius": 56,
    "eliok": 19,
}

**Vendor note: Inkmill markdown pipeline**

Rendering for Parchway docs is outsourced to Inkmill under an annual contract, renewing each March. They handle sanitization and PDF export; we own the upload queue. SLA: 4-hour response on rendering failures. Escalate only after two failed retries. Their support desk is reachable at the address below.

billing contact of hahaf-baguf = zorael.tammir.jorius@sivrelhq.internal

### Step 4 — Enable log sampling on Chirpvane

Chirpvane emits ~40k lines/min. Set sampling to 1:50 for INFO, keep WARN+ unsampled. Deploy the sampler sidecar before flipping the flag, or you'll drop errors during the gap. Verify counts in the ingest dashboard for 10 minutes post-flip. Sampling rules are stored in the config DB; connect with this string:

primary connection of yagep-kahip = redis://giliel_svc:zYiKsLL2PLpfPL@db-348f.xolmarsys.corp:5432/fenwyn